Hi folks. I am hoping to get some advice from someone who's changed their RT stock handlebars over to the tube type bars. I know there's a kit to do this from Verholen or Eurotech but have any of you done this? I would really like to be able to change my bars to something about an inch lower and an inch more forward. Since all the wiring for the heated grips and such is on the outside I can see no real problems in switching over but advice from someone who's done the swap would surely be appreciated. Thanks.

You might also be able to swap out a pair of the cast bars from the pre-20011/2 R1100R. They look very similar to the RT bars but are a little lower and a little more forward. I'm not sure about the bolt pattern.
